diff options
author | Martin Schanzenbach <schanzen@gnunet.org> | 2022-02-25 19:50:47 +0100 |
---|---|---|
committer | Martin Schanzenbach <schanzen@gnunet.org> | 2022-02-25 19:50:47 +0100 |
commit | 1c7195b13b6288ada1fb982d9817945aacb707b4 (patch) | |
tree | b9196549a374fab191262d4350b71a81cfb54c93 | |
parent | 57045d2b7c095481650048c19bf9e194463f7983 (diff) | |
download | lsd0001-1c7195b13b6288ada1fb982d9817945aacb707b4.tar.gz lsd0001-1c7195b13b6288ada1fb982d9817945aacb707b4.zip |
fix supplemental records with ZDs and redirsv10
-rw-r--r-- | draft-schanzen-gns.xml | 16 |
1 files changed, 13 insertions, 3 deletions
diff --git a/draft-schanzen-gns.xml b/draft-schanzen-gns.xml index 277113f..46dba5a 100644 --- a/draft-schanzen-gns.xml +++ b/draft-schanzen-gns.xml | |||
@@ -938,7 +938,10 @@ zTLD[126..129].zTLD[63..125].zTLD[0..62] | |||
938 | A zone delegation record payload contains the public key of | 938 | A zone delegation record payload contains the public key of |
939 | the zone to delegate to. | 939 | the zone to delegate to. |
940 | A zone delegation record <bcp14>MUST</bcp14> have the CRTITICAL flag set | 940 | A zone delegation record <bcp14>MUST</bcp14> have the CRTITICAL flag set |
941 | and <bcp14>MUST</bcp14> be the only record under a label. | 941 | and <bcp14>MUST</bcp14> be the only non-supplemental record under a label. |
942 | There <bcp14>MAY</bcp14> be inactive records of the same type which have | ||
943 | the SHADOW flag set in order to facilitate smooth key rollovers. | ||
944 | flag set | ||
942 | No other records are allowed. | 945 | No other records are allowed. |
943 | </t> | 946 | </t> |
944 | <section anchor="gnsrecords_pkey" numbered="true" toc="default"> | 947 | <section anchor="gnsrecords_pkey" numbered="true" toc="default"> |
@@ -1404,7 +1407,11 @@ S-Decrypt(zk,label,expiration,ciphertext): | |||
1404 | <name>REDIRECT</name> | 1407 | <name>REDIRECT</name> |
1405 | <t> | 1408 | <t> |
1406 | A REDIRECT record is the GNS equivalent of a CNAME record in DNS. | 1409 | A REDIRECT record is the GNS equivalent of a CNAME record in DNS. |
1407 | A REDIRECT record <bcp14>MUST</bcp14> be the only record under a label. | 1410 | A REDIRECT record <bcp14>MUST</bcp14> be the only non-supplemental |
1411 | record under a label. | ||
1412 | There <bcp14>MAY</bcp14> be inactive records of the same type which have | ||
1413 | the SHADOW flag set in order to facilitate smooth changes of redirection | ||
1414 | targets. | ||
1408 | No other records are allowed. | 1415 | No other records are allowed. |
1409 | Details on processing of this record is defined in <xref target="redirect_processing"/>. | 1416 | Details on processing of this record is defined in <xref target="redirect_processing"/>. |
1410 | 1417 | ||
@@ -1443,7 +1450,10 @@ S-Decrypt(zk,label,expiration,ciphertext): | |||
1443 | There <bcp14>MAY</bcp14> be multiple GNS2DNS records under a label. | 1450 | There <bcp14>MAY</bcp14> be multiple GNS2DNS records under a label. |
1444 | There <bcp14>MAY</bcp14> also be DNSSEC DS records or any other records used to | 1451 | There <bcp14>MAY</bcp14> also be DNSSEC DS records or any other records used to |
1445 | secure the connection with the DNS servers under the same label. | 1452 | secure the connection with the DNS servers under the same label. |
1446 | No other record types are allowed in the same record set. | 1453 | There <bcp14>MAY</bcp14> be inactive records of the same type(s) which have |
1454 | the SHADOW flag set in order to facilitate smooth changes of redirection | ||
1455 | targets. | ||
1456 | No other non-supplemental record types are allowed in the same record set. | ||
1447 | A GNS2DNS DATA entry is illustrated in <xref target="figure_gns2dnsrecord"/>.</t> | 1457 | A GNS2DNS DATA entry is illustrated in <xref target="figure_gns2dnsrecord"/>.</t> |
1448 | <figure anchor="figure_gns2dnsrecord" title="The GNS2DNS DATA Wire Format."> | 1458 | <figure anchor="figure_gns2dnsrecord" title="The GNS2DNS DATA Wire Format."> |
1449 | <artwork name="" type="" align="left" alt=""><![CDATA[ | 1459 | <artwork name="" type="" align="left" alt=""><![CDATA[ |